Follow the steps to complete your building permit application effectively.
- Click ‘Get Form’ button to access the application form and open it in your preferred PDF editor or online form editor.
- Begin by completing SECTION I: PROPERTY INFORMATION. Enter the project address, city, and zip code accurately. Be thorough and include any necessary details such as building numbers and suite numbers.
- Continue by providing the legal description if applicable. Include information on the township, parcel number, and subdivision for new constructions.
- In the same section, ensure you include the signatures and dates for the property owner and contractor or authorized agent. This is crucial for processing.
- Moving on to SECTION II: PEOPLE INFORMATION, fill out the contact details for the property owner and contractor, including names, business names, and phone numbers.
- Complete the utility information, specifying the water meter size, heating source, and any particular requirements or existing conditions.
- In SECTION III: PROPOSED WORK, describe the type of work you are undertaking. Check all relevant boxes for the work that applies to your project, such as new construction or remodel.
- Provide a detailed project description explaining the work that will be completed. This detail is important for the review process.
- Finally, review SECTION V: FEES. Calculate your total due including building fees, review fees, and other applicable fees. Ensure you indicate the payment method and complete any necessary payment information.
- After ensuring all sections are completed, review the entire application for accuracy. Save your changes and download or print the completed form for your records or submission.
